Weather in May

May, the last month of the spring in Cool, is another warm month, with an average temperature varying between 63.3°F (17.4°C) and 82.4°F (28°C).

Temperature

A subtle rise in the average high-temperature is observed during May, adjusting from a moderately hot 75.7°F (24.3°C) in April to a still warm 82.4°F (28°C). In May, the temperature drops to an average of 63.3°F (17.4°C) at night.

Heat index

Throughout May, the heat index is computed to be a tropical 87.8°F (31°C). If one remains active during constant exposure, it might cause exhaustion and heat cramps.
One should be cognizant that the heat index values are tailored for shaded spots and mild winds. Being exposed to direct sunshine might trigger a heat index increase by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'felt air temperature' or 'apparent temperature', reflects the feeling of heat when considering both air temperature and humidity. Additional elements encompassing metabolic differences, the degree of physical activity, and attire can impact the individual's perception of temperature. Given the impact of direct sunlight, it's noteworthy that the felt temperature can rise by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are highly critical for babies and toddlers. Young children typically face greater hazards than adults because they do not sweat as much. Their larger skin surface in comparison to their little bodies and the high heat production from their active nature compounds their vulnerability.

Humidity

With an average relative humidity of 71%, May is the most humid month in Cool.

Rainfall

In Cool, in May, during 12.7 rainfall days, 2.99" (76mm) of precipitation is typically accumulated. In Cool, during the entire year, the rain falls for 116.6 days and collects up to 22.64" (575mm) of precipitation.

Snowfall

April through October are months without snowfall.

Daylight

The average length of the day in May in Cool is 13h and 52min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 6:43 am and sunset at 8:14 pm. On the last day of May, in Cool, sunrise is at 6:24 am and sunset at 8:34 pm CDT.

Sunshine

In Cool, the average sunshine in May is 9.3h.

UV index

In Cool, the average daily maximum UV index in May is 6. A UV Index of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high health risk from exposure to the Sun's UV rays for the ordinary person.
Note: The daily high UV index of 6 during May translates into the following recommendations:
Uphold preventive measures and conform to sun safety guidelines. Defending against skin and eye harm is crucial. The hours from 10 a.m. to 4 p.m. have the most intense UV radiation. As much as possible, limit direct sun exposure during this period. In the presence of strong sunlight, it's crucial to wear sunglasses that ward off UVA and UVB rays.
